NCR Atleos’ Cashzone Network Expands into Italy, Enabling Convenient Access to Cash
NCR Atleos Corporation (NYSE: NATL) (“Atleos”), a leader in expanding self-service financial access for financial institutions, retailers and consumers, today announced that it has expanded its ATM network, under the Cashzone brand, into Italy, providing easy access to cash for both residents and tourists. Atleos is the world’s largest independent ATM operator. This marks the thirteenth country worldwide in which Atleos has an ATM network presence.
Italy is a cash-dependent country. With the deployment of this new ATM network, consumers will be able to withdraw cash at premier retail locations across the country. While consumers benefit from the convenience of the network, retailers gain value from the additional foot traffic and new revenue opportunities. Plus, banks can extend their reach and better serve customers without the burdensome capital expenditure of a new physical branch.
“Cash is a common everyday way to pay in Italy, as well as a significant convenience for visitors,” explained Diego Navarrete, executive vice president, Global Sales for Atleos. “With the implementation of this ATM network in Italy, consumers can self-serve with simplicity and ease and retailers can create more profitable, engaging customer experiences. This is another example of the growing momentum of utility ATM networks.”
